Understanding the pig gestation calendar is essential for any operation focused on swine, whether it is a large-scale commercial enterprise or a small heritage breed farm. This biological timeline dictates the rhythm of the herd, influencing everything from feed budgeting and labor allocation to market planning and facility management. The average duration, measured from the first day of the last breeding to the day of farrowing, sits at approximately 114 days, a period often remembered by the agricultural mnemonic "three months, three weeks, and three days." However, this number is not a rigid deadline but a statistical average, with individual sows and gilts typically farrowing within a window of 111 to 117 days. Precision in tracking this calendar allows for optimal nutrition, reduces the risk of stillbirths, and ensures that veterinary interventions, such as vaccinations, are timed with precision.
The Biological Phases of Gestation
The physiological journey of a sow through gestation is divided into distinct phases, each with specific embryonic and fetal development milestones. The initial phase, covering days 1 to 30, is critical for embryo survival and implantation, where the foundation for the placenta is established. Days 30 to 80 mark the period of organogenesis and rapid fetal growth, making nutrition during this stage vital for the eventual size and vigor of the litter. The final phase, spanning days 80 to 114, is characterized by the most significant weight gain as the fetuses reach their final size and the sow’s body prepares for the immense physical task of farrowing. Managing the sow’s diet to match these phases prevents metabolic stress and supports healthy development without excessive weight gain that could complicate delivery.
Key Factors Influencing Gestation Length
While the 114-day average provides a reliable baseline, several variables can cause the gestation period to deviate slightly from this norm. Genetic lineage plays a role, with certain breeds known to have slightly shorter or longer gestations. The parity of the sow is also significant; first-time gilts often have a slightly shorter gestation compared to older, seasoned sows. Furthermore, environmental factors such as temperature and stress can act as triggers, potentially shortening the gestation if the sow experiences extreme heat or significant disturbances late in the cycle. Accurate record-keeping for each individual animal is the only way to account for these variations and predict farrowing dates with confidence.
Practical Management and Record-Keeping
Effective management of the pig gestation calendar relies heavily on meticulous record-keeping and the use of a centralized tracking system. Producers utilize specialized software or physical logbooks to document the exact date of breeding, whether natural or artificial insemination, and calculate the expected farrowing date based on the 114-day rule. This calendar then becomes a visual dashboard, allowing managers to monitor the progress of each sow and identify those approaching their due date. Such foresight is critical for arranging farrowing assistance, preparing clean and safe crates, and ensuring that colostrum and milk replacement supplements are on hand for the newborn piglets.
Utilizing Technology for Precision
Modern technology has revolutionized the way producers handle the gestation calendar, moving beyond simple manual calculations. Electronic identification tags paired with herd management software can automatically record breeding dates and send alerts as the farrowing window approaches. Some advanced systems integrate weight monitoring and feed intake data to adjust the gestation timeline predictions based on the individual health and condition of the sow. This data-driven approach minimizes human error, ensures that no animal is overlooked, and allows for a more proactive rather than reactive approach to herd health and production planning.
